[PATCH v3 2/2] serial: 8250_dw: Use a fixed CPR value for UltraRISC DP1000 UART

Jia Wang wangjia at ultrarisc.com
Wed Apr 22 02:51:36 PDT 2026


On 2026-04-22 12:43 +0300, Andy Shevchenko wrote:
> On Wed, Apr 22, 2026 at 05:39:41PM +0800, Jia Wang wrote:
> > On 2026-04-22 11:46 +0300, Andy Shevchenko wrote:
> > > On Wed, Apr 22, 2026 at 11:45:44AM +0300, Andy Shevchenko wrote:
> > > > On Wed, Apr 22, 2026 at 08:57:56AM +0800, Jia Wang wrote:
> 
> ...
> 
> > > > > Just to confirm: since you mentioned that the preparatory patch moving
> > > > > the DW_UART register defines is already in place, I don't need to move
> > > > > them again, correct?
> > > > > 
> > > > > I will update my patch to use the DW_UART_CPR_* macros and
> > > > > FIELD_PREP_CONST() accordingly, and I’m happy to add a separate patch in
> > > > > the next revision to convert the Renesas .cpr_value as well.
> > > > 
> > > > My understanding that you want to send a patch series of 3 patches:
> > > > - moving DW_UART_CPR_* values from C-file to h-file
> > > > - modify existing Renesas case
> > > 
> > > - DT binding for new HW (patch 1 of this series)
> > > 
> > > > - add support for your HW (this patch in updated form)
> > 
> > Yes, I will follow this order and resend the series in v4.
> 
> Thanks, and since Ilpo mentioned, move all DW_UART_* register offsets/bitfields
> to the header file (in patch 1 of a new series).
>

Thanks, got it. I’ll follow this in v4.
 
> > > And I forgot that you have a DT binging one... So 4 patches after all.
> 
> -- 
> With Best Regards,
> Andy Shevchenko
> 
> 
> 

Regards,
Jia Wang





More information about the linux-riscv mailing list